7. Your ARCO rights

Under the LFPDPPP, you may exercise your rights of:

  • Access — find out what data we hold about you and how we use it
  • Rectification — correct inaccurate or outdated data
  • Cancellation — request that we delete it
  • Opposition — object to the use of your data for specific purposes

You may also withdraw your consent at any time and limit the use or disclosure of your data.

To exercise these rights, send your request to marketing@mionko.com including: your full name, a means of contact, a copy of official identification, a clear description of the data your request concerns, and any documents supporting it.

We will respond within a maximum of 20 business days and, if the request is valid, act on it within the following 15 business days.

If you believe your request was not handled properly, you may file a complaint with Mexico’s National Institute for Transparency, Access to Information and Personal Data Protection (INAI): www.inai.org.mx
